**Responsibilities**:
- Administers various human resource plans and procedures for all company employees; assists in the development and implementation of policies and procedures; maintains employee handbook and policies and procedures manual.
- Maintains accurate job descriptions
- Performs benefits administration to include claims resolution, change reporting and communicating benefit information to employees
- Conducts recruitment effort for all positions, temporary employees; conducts new-employee on-boarding; writes and places advertisements.
- Verifies accurate time clock records, maintains pay schedule for temporary staff members
- Supports continued education of employees by searching, reviewing, registering employees in applicable programs
- Maintains human resource information system records and compiles reports from the database
- Maintains compliance with federal and provincial regulations concerning employment
- Administer WSIB program, completing and submitting appropriate paperwork
- Conducts safety training for new employees and annually or periodically provides job safety specific training for all employees.
- Conduct/chair JHSC and periodic safety meetings and regular on-site inspections.
- Monitors the safe operations & compliance of all safety & health rules and procedures by all employees.
- Will lead accident/near miss investigations. Assists and ensures that investigations and training are done and follows up with Department Managers on implementation of any corrective actions.
- Responsible for maintenance of SDS records and hazardous chemical lists.
- Conducts hazard analysis (JSA’s) and assists in the development of policy recommendations for safe operations.
- Conducts annual fire drills, spill response, WHMIS and LOTO for the entire facility.
- Prepares and presents safety reports, TRIF, IIR, 1st Aid room Data, etc.
- Maintains H&S communication boards - including posting for legislative requirements
